1. Make sure your website is mobile-friendly

Google’s latest algorithm update, “Mobilegeddon,” has put mobile-friendliness at the top of the list for many website owners. Google’s stated goal is to provide users with the best possible experience, and they believe that mobile-friendly websites are a big part of that. There are a few things you can do to make sure your website makes the cut.

First, check to see if your website is already mobile-friendly by using Google’s Mobile-Friendly Test tool. If it isn’t, there are a few steps you can take to fix it. Google recommends using responsive design, which means that your website will automatically adjust to fit any screen size. You can also use separate URLs for mobile and desktop versions of your site. Google also recommends using large font sizes and buttons and avoiding Flash or other plugins that might not work on mobile devices. By following these tips, you can help Google—and your users—have a better experience with your website.

 

2. Use keyword-rich titles and descriptions for your pages

It’s no secret that Google is the biggest player in the game when it comes to search engines. And that means that if you want your pages to be found by Google users, you need to make sure your titles and descriptions are keyword-rich. Here are a few tips for how to do just that.

First, choose your keywords carefully. Make sure they are relevant to the content on your page and that they are popular enough that people are actually searching for them. You can use Google’s Keyword Planner tool to help with this.

Once you have your keywords, use them in both your title and your description. But don’t stuff them in there – just use them naturally so that they flow well. Google will penalize you if it feels like you’re trying to cram too many keywords into your title or description.

And finally, remember that your title and description are not just for Google – they’re also for humans. So make sure they are interesting and engaging, as well as keyword-rich. If they are, people will be more likely to click on your result when it comes up in a search engine, and that means more traffic for you.

 

3. Add fresh, new content on a regular basis

Google is always changing, and that means that the content on your website needs to be fresh and up-to-date. Google loves new content, and they are constantly tweaking their algorithms to reward sites that provide it. Of course, adding new content on a regular basis can be a challenge.

One way to make it easier is to create a schedule and set aside time each week to add new material. It doesn’t have to be a lot – even a few hundred words can make a difference. You can also make things easier by repurposing old content. For example, if you have an article that’s been sitting in your archives for a while, you can update it with new information and republish it. By taking these steps, you can ensure that your site always has fresh, new content – and that Google will keep sending traffic your way.

5. Use Google’s own tools to help you improve your website ranking

One of the best ways to improve your website’s ranking is to use Google’s own tools. Google provides a number of free services that can help you boost your site’s visibility and draw in more traffic. For example, Google Search Console is a powerful tool that can help you track your website’s performance in Google search results. You can use Search Console to see how often your site appears in Google search results, what keywords people are using to find your site, and whether there are any errors that are preventing your site from being indexed properly. Backlinks are another important factor in Google’s ranking algorithm, and Google Webmaster Tools can help you track the backlinks pointing to your site. By using Google’s tools to improve your website’s ranking, you can make sure that your site is being seen by the people who are most likely to be interested in it.
